What Materials Make Quick Drying Hiking Shoes Ideal for Women?
The materials that make quick drying hiking shoes ideal for women include:
- Mesh: Mesh is a lightweight and breathable fabric that allows for excellent airflow, helping to wick away moisture and promote quick drying. This material also provides flexibility and comfort, making it perfect for long hikes.
- Synthetic Leather: Synthetic leather offers durability and water resistance while being lighter than traditional leather. This material is often treated to repel water, ensuring that the shoes remain lightweight and dry even in wet conditions.
- Gore-Tex: Gore-Tex is a waterproof and breathable membrane that keeps feet dry from external moisture while allowing sweat to escape. Shoes made with Gore-Tex are particularly beneficial for hiking in wet environments without sacrificing comfort.
- EVA Foam: Ethylene-vinyl acetate (EVA) foam is commonly used in the midsole of hiking shoes for cushioning and support. It is lightweight and quick-drying, providing comfort during long treks without adding extra weight.
- Rubber Outsoles: Rubber outsoles offer excellent grip and traction on various terrains, ensuring stability while hiking. Many quick drying hiking shoes incorporate a tread pattern designed for quick water drainage, enhancing performance in wet conditions.

What Factors Should Women Consider When Selecting Quick Drying Hiking Shoes?
When selecting quick drying hiking shoes, women should consider several important factors to ensure comfort, performance, and protection during outdoor activities.
- Material: The shoe’s upper material is crucial for quick drying capabilities. Look for shoes made from synthetic materials like mesh or nylon, which allow for better breathability and water drainage, ensuring that your feet dry faster after wet conditions.
- Weight: Lightweight shoes are essential for hiking, as they reduce fatigue over long distances. A lighter shoe minimizes the effort required to lift your foot, enhancing agility and making the hike more enjoyable.
- Fit and Comfort: Proper fit is paramount in hiking shoes to prevent blisters and discomfort. It’s advisable to try on shoes with the socks you plan to wear during hikes and to ensure there is adequate space in the toe box and a snug fit around the heel.
- Traction: The outsole of the shoe should provide excellent grip on various terrains. Look for shoes with rubber outsoles that feature aggressive tread patterns to enhance stability and prevent slipping on wet or uneven surfaces.
- Water Resistance: While quick drying is essential, having some level of water resistance can also be beneficial. Shoes with a water-repellent treatment help keep your feet dry during unexpected weather changes while still allowing for rapid drying when wet.
- Cushioning: Adequate cushioning affects comfort and shock absorption during hikes. A well-cushioned shoe will help reduce impact on the joints, making longer hikes more comfortable and less strenuous.
- Support: Look for shoes that provide good arch and ankle support, especially if you plan on hiking on rugged terrain. Proper support helps to stabilize your foot and reduces the risk of injuries during your hike.
- Durability: Choose shoes made with durable materials and construction methods to ensure they can withstand the rigors of hiking. Investing in a high-quality pair will not only improve performance but also provide longevity, saving money in the long run.
